Innovation Can Drive Profitability Higher

While most investors are focused on big tech names right now, conventional companies also benefit from today’s tech trends. Companies that can integrate new technologies can provide better service, and potentially even keep costs down.

  • A company that has the lowest costs in the industry tends to have low profit margins. But it also has a big market share, as consumers are largely price-focused. That can still lead to great returns, especially as new technology improves profit margins.

    Retail isn’t known for big profit margins. And there’s some steep competition. Walmart (WMT) is looking to keep competition at bay with investments in technologies like drone deliveries.

    Its new drone delivery service can even drop off eggs at your door without breaking any. So far, that puts them a bit ahead of competitors.

    Action to take: Shares of the retail leader are priced at about 25 times forward earnings, about in-line with how they usually trade. It’s clear they’re working to keep and grow their market share with new technologies, so they can likely continue to expand revenues for some time.
